[PATCH] Add timestamp field to process events
authorMatt Helsley <matthltc@us.ibm.com>
Mon, 12 Dec 2005 08:37:10 +0000 (00:37 -0800)
committerLinus Torvalds <torvalds@g5.osdl.org>
Mon, 12 Dec 2005 16:57:42 +0000 (08:57 -0800)
commit5650b736ad328f7f3e4120e8790940289b8ac144
treefb2287d21b6f826f3e291892c3d5c6e640a13c45
parent64123fd42c7a1e4ebf6acd2399c98caddc7e0c26
[PATCH] Add timestamp field to process events

This adds a timestamp field to the events sent via the process event
connector.  The timestamp allows listeners to accurately account the
duration(s) between a process' events and offers strong means with which
to determine the order of events with respect to a given task while also
avoiding the addition of per-task data.

This alters the size and layout of the event structure and hence would
break compatibility if process events connector as it stands in 2.6.15-rc2
were released as a mainline kernel.

Signed-off-by: Matt Helsley <matthltc@us.ibm.com>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
drivers/connector/cn_proc.c
include/linux/cn_proc.h